AudioQuest DragonFly Copper

Compacte USB DAC, hoofdtelefoonversterker en voorversterker

De AudioQuest DragonFly Copper brengt hoogwaardige audioprestaties binnen handbereik. Deze compacte USB DAC (digitaal-naar-analoogomzetter), hoofdtelefoonversterker en voorversterker omzeilt de vaak beperkte audiocircuits van laptops, computers, smartphones en tablets. Het resultaat? Een aanzienlijk schoner, gedetailleerder en natuurlijker geluid voor hoofdtelefoons, actieve luidsprekers en complete audiosystemen.

Verbeterde prestaties

De DragonFly Copper behoudt alle kwaliteiten die de serie zo populair maakten, maar tilt de prestaties naar een hoger niveau. Dankzij een nieuwe generatie 32-bit ESS Sabre DAC en een geoptimaliseerd ontwerp levert de Copper:

  • Twee keer zoveel uitgangsvermogen als eerdere DragonFly-modellen
  • Tot 25% lager stroomverbruik
  • Lagere vervorming voor een nog zuiverder geluid
  • Verbeterde afvoer van RF-ruis dankzij de hoogwaardige koperkleurige behuizing

Compatibel met vrijwel elk apparaat

De DragonFly Copper werkt probleemloos met:

  • Windows- en Apple-computers
  • iPhone en iPad (met geschikte adapter)
  • De meeste Android-smartphones en tablets
  • Actieve luidsprekers, versterkers en hoofdtelefoons

Dankzij volledige ondersteuning voor USB Audio Class (UAC) zijn er geen extra stuurprogramma’s nodig.

Hi-Res Audio in zakformaat

Of u nu luistert naar MP3-bestanden, streamingdiensten of hoge-resolutie audiobestanden, de DragonFly Copper haalt meer detail, dynamiek en muzikaliteit uit uw muziekcollectie. Het verlichte DragonFly-logo geeft bovendien direct de samplefrequentie van het afgespeelde bestand weer:

  • Groen: 44,1 kHz
  • Blauw: 48 kHz
  • Geel: 88,2 kHz
  • Lichtblauw: 96 kHz
  • Rood: Stand-by
